Places to Eat:
1. The Brisket House: This family-owned barbecue joint is a hidden gem located off the beaten path. Savor tender, slow-cooked meats paired with mouthwatering sides - a must-visit for barbecue enthusiasts.
2. La Casa De Tacos: For authentic Mexican cuisine, look no further than this cozy taqueria. Their breakfast tacos are a local favorite, and their homemade tortillas are a must-try.
3. Abel's Cafe: Located in the heart of Webster, this quaint cafe serves up delectable breakfast and brunch options. Their migas and breakfast burritos are unmissable.
4. The Craft Grill: This modern gastropub offers an eclectic mix of elevated comfort food and craft beers. Try their iconic burger or one of their seasonal specials.
5. Max's Wine Dive: This intimate, upscale eatery offers an extensive wine selection and a menu that combines Southern comfort with gourmet cuisine. Be sure to try their famous mac and cheese.
